Setup>Pumps and Lines>PLLD
0.2 gph (0.76lph) Line Leak Test
Touch to select the scheduling frequency of the 0.2 gph (0.76lph) periodic
tests:
Disabled - No manual, repetitive, or monthly 0.2 gph (0.76lph) testing is
allowed. This is the default.
Repetitive - After a dispense, a 3.0 gph (11.3lph) test is run, followed by a
0.2 gph (0.76lph) test. The test blockout period (the Precision Test Delay
in “Setup>Pumps and Lines>All PLLD”) is then observed. Following the
test blockout period, the test sequence repeats after the next dispense.
NOTE: If the 0.1 gph (0.3 lph) test is set for
Repetitive, this test must also
be set to Repetitive. This selection also enables manual 0.2 gph (0.76lph)
tests to run when manually started.
Monthly - The test is scheduled at the beginning of a new month and
remains scheduled until a test is passed.
Manual - 0.2 gph (0.76lph) tests run only when manually started in Diagnos-
tics>PLLD>Manual Tests
0.1 gph (0.38lph) Line Leak Test
Touch to select the scheduling frequency of the 0.1 gph (0.38lph) precision
tests.
Disabled - No manual or automatic 0.1 gph (0.3 lph) testing is allowed. This
is the default.
Repetitive - After a dispense, a 3.0 gph (11.3lph) test is run, a 0.2 gph
(0.76lph) test is run, followed by the 0.1 gph (0.38lph) test. The test blockout
period (the Precision Test Delay in “Setup>Pumps and Lines>All PLLD”)
is then observed. Following the test blockout period, the test sequence
repeats after the next dispense. This selection also enables manual 0.1 gph
(0.38lph) testing tests to run when manually started.
Auto - The 0.1 gph (0.38lph) test is automatically scheduled ro tun 6 months
after the last passed 0.1 gph (0.38lph) test. This setting also gives you the
option to run the Passive 0.1 gph (0.38lph) Line Leak Test.
Manual - 0.1 gph (0.38lph) test runs only when manually started in Diagnos-
tics>PLLD>Manual Tests.
Passive 0.1 gph (0.38lph) Line Leak Test
[only available if the pipe type is user-defined and the 0.1 gph (0.38lph) Line
Leak Test is set to Auto].
Enables a 0.1 gph (0.38lph) test to run after a passed 0.2 gph (0.76lph) test
without the 0.1 gph (0.38lph) test being actively scheduled. If the 0.1 gph
(0.38lph) test also passes, you are notified in Diagnostics>PLLD> 0.1 GPH
Tests. If it fails, there is no notification of the passive 0.1 gph (0.38lph) test.
Allowable selections: Yes, No (default is No).
Shutdown Rate
The line is shut down if a specified or less precise PLLD test fails. For exam-
ple, if you set the shutdown rate for 0.2 gph (0.76lph), the line will shut down
if it fails both the 3.0 gph (11.3lph) test and the 0.2 gph (0.76lph) test.
Allowable selections: 3.0 gph (11.3lph), 0.2 gph (0.76lph), 0.1gph (0.38lph),
or None (default is 3.0 gph (11.3lph).
Low Pressure Shutoff
If a low pressure is detected during dispense, the Low Pressure Alarm is
triggered. The dispenser also halts dispensing if this field is enabled and the
pressure is less than the
Low Pressure Shutoff Value field below.
Allowable selections: Disabled, Enabled (default is Disabled).
Low Pressure Shutoff Value
If a low pressure is detected during dispense, a low pressure alarm is trig-
gered. The dispenser also halts dispensing if the pressure is lower than the
value in this field.
Allowable selections: 0 to 25 psi (0 to 172kPa)
Default: 0.0
Continuous Handle Timeout
If the dispenser handle remains off the hook for the period of time entered in
this field, the line is shut down by the console.
Allowable selections: 1 to 16 hours. Default: 16 hours
Fuel Out Limit
If the tank product level is below the limit entered in this field, the Fuel Out
Alarm is triggered.
Allowable selections: 0.00 to 15.00 in (0.00 to 381.00mm). Default: 10.00 in
(254mm).
Altitude Pressure Offset
Allows you to set an altitude pressure adjustment for the absolute pressure
transducer of plus or minus 5psi.
Allowable selections: -5.0 to 5.0. Default: 0.0.
